Baseball Preview: New Paltz Huguenots vs. Our Lady of Lourdes Warriors        
        
		
            
 After three games on the road, New Paltz is heading back home. They will take on the Our Lady of Lourdes Warriors at 4:15  p.m.  on Thursday. New Paltz is strutting in with some hitting muscle, as they've averaged 6.4  runs per game  this season.
 On Wednesday, New Paltz narrowly escaped with a  win as the  squad sidled past Beacon  8-7.
  Jack Maiale made a splash no matter where he played. On the mound, he  pitched three innings while giving up   no  earned runs off   four  hits. Maiale was also solid in the batter's box,  going 1-for-3 with a  stolen base and  an  RBI.
 In other batting news,  the team  relied heavily on  Justin Coiteux, who  scored two  runs and  stole two bases while going 3-for-4.  Jared Johnson was another key contributor,  scoring two  runs and  stealing a base while going 2-for-2.
 Meanwhile, it was a hard-fought  matchup, but Our Lady of Lourdes had to settle for  a  7-6 defeat against Wallkill on Tuesday.
 New Paltz now  has a winning record of 3-2. As for Our Lady of Lourdes, their loss dropped their record down to 1-4.
 New Paltz beat Our Lady of Lourdes 11-6  when the teams last played  back in April of 2023. Will New Paltz repeat their success,  or does  Our Lady of Lourdes have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
